Ingredients You’ll Need

Simple ingredients make the Spiced Peanut Butter Yogurt Dip Recipe a breeze to prepare, yet each one plays an essential role in perfecting its taste, texture, and color. From creamy peanut butter to warming spices, these elements come together beautifully.

  • Vanilla Greek yogurt: Provides a tangy and creamy base with a hint of sweetness that balances the spices perfectly.
  • Creamy peanut butter: Adds richness and a nutty depth that’s the heart of this dip’s character.
  • Milk: Used to adjust the dip’s consistency to silky smoothness, making it easier to scoop or drizzle.
  • Ground cinnamon: Offers warmth and a sweet-spicy aroma that makes every bite inviting.
  • Ground nutmeg: Brings a subtle earthiness and complexity without overpowering the other flavors.
  • Ground red chile pepper: Gives a gentle heat that wakes up the palate and adds a delightful contrast to the sweetness.
  • Salt: Enhances all the flavors and balances the sweetness, so every ingredient shines.

How to Make Spiced Peanut Butter Yogurt Dip Recipe

Step 1: Gather and Measure

Start by bringing all your ingredients together in one bowl. Measuring everything carefully now ensures a perfectly balanced dip that hits all the right flavor notes. Use vanilla Greek yogurt and creamy peanut butter as your base, adding the spices and a pinch of salt to build layers of taste.

Step 2: Combine Ingredients

Place the Greek yogurt, peanut butter, milk, cinnamon, nutmeg, red chile pepper, and salt into a mixing bowl. This mixture promises the creamy texture and the inviting aroma that make this dip so special.

Step 3: Beat to Perfection

Using an electric mixer, beat the mixture until it becomes light and fluffy. This step is key, as it incorporates air and smooths out any lumps, transforming the dip into an irresistible, spreadable treat that’s easy to serve and enjoy.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Store any leftover Spiced Peanut Butter Yogurt Dip Recipe in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will keep well for up to three days, making it perfect for quick snacks or unexpected guests.

Freezing

This dip isn’t ideal for freezing due to its creamy yogurt base, which can separate and change texture when thawed, so it’s best enjoyed fresh or refrigerated.

Reheating

Since this dip is meant to be served cold or at room temperature, reheating isn’t necessary. If the dip feels too thick after refrigeration, simply stir in a little milk to bring back its smooth consistency before serving.

FAQs

Can I use natural peanut butter instead of creamy?

Absolutely! Natural peanut butter will work fine, but keep in mind it may alter the texture slightly, making the dip less smooth. Just beat it a bit longer to incorporate any oil separation.

Is there a dairy-free alternative for this recipe?

You can substitute the Greek yogurt with coconut or almond milk yogurt, and use a dairy-free milk alternative. The flavors will shift slightly but remain delicious and creamy.

How spicy is the dip? Can I adjust the heat?

The ground red chile pepper adds a gentle warmth that balances the sweetness and richness. Feel free to reduce or omit it if you prefer a milder flavor, or add a pinch more if you like extra kick.

Can I make this dip ahead of time for parties?

Yes, the dip actually benefits from resting for an hour or so to let the flavors meld. Just keep it chilled and give it a quick whisk before serving to refresh the texture.

What other spices can I experiment with?

Try adding a touch of ground cardamom or ginger for different warm spice notes. A small amount of vanilla extract can also enhance the dip’s sweetness and aroma.

Ingredients

Scale

Dip Ingredients

  • 2 cups vanilla Greek yogurt
  • 1 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 1 tablespoon milk, or more to taste
  • ¼ te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• â…› te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• â…› teaspoon ground red chile pepper
  • â…› teaspoon salt


Instructions

  1. Combine Ingredients: In a medium bowl, add the vanilla Greek yogurt, creamy peanut butter, milk, ground cinnamon, ground nutmeg, ground red chile pepper, and salt. This combination forms the delicious base of the dip.
  2. Mix Until Fluffy: Using an electric mixer, beat the mixture until it becomes light and fluffy, ensuring the peanut butter and spices are evenly incorporated for a smooth, creamy dip.

Notes

  • If the dip is too thick, gradually add more milk 1 teaspoon at a time until desired consistency is reached.
  • This dip pairs well with fresh fruit, crackers, or pretzels for a tasty snack.
  • Adjust the amount of red chile pepper according to your preferred spice level.
  • For a dairy-free version, substitute Greek yogurt with a plant-based yogurt and use peanut butter without added dairy.
